  • GeForce GTX 280M SLI has 650% more power consumption, than GeForce MX350.
  • GeForce GTX 280M SLI and GeForce MX350 have maximum RAM of 2 GB.
  • Both cards are used in Laptops.
  • GeForce GTX 280M SLI is build with G9x architecture, and GeForce MX350 - with Pascal.
  • Core clock speed of GeForce MX350 is 769 MHz higher, than GeForce GTX 280M SLI.
  • GeForce GTX 280M SLI is manufactured by 55 nm process technology, and GeForce MX350 - by 14 nm process technology.
  • Memory clock speed of GeForce MX350 is 6050 MHz higher, than GeForce GTX 280M SLI.
